Learn How to Spot Mate in 1: Kingside Attack
This puzzle is a classic middlegame mating pattern where the attacking side has direct access to the enemy king. The key idea is to recognize when the king’s shelter has been weakened and a queen can exploit the open lines around it. In positions like this, material count matters far less than king safety: a single forcing move can end the game immediately. Always scan for checks first, especially when the opponent’s queen and bishop are already active near the king.
